Transaction 2d1b24dcfc7154a46c03bee540bec3c967c26847c648baa130dfed8f94954264
1 Input
1 Outputs
- 2d1b24dcfc7154a46c03bee540bec3c967c26847c648baa130dfed8f94954264:0
value 260146
address 1QFE5d4iyarboiBhMS3grb8Z5CWdajDMLf